Index: chrome/browser/extensions/api/developer_private/developer_private_api_unittest.cc |
diff --git a/chrome/browser/extensions/api/developer_private/developer_private_api_unittest.cc b/chrome/browser/extensions/api/developer_private/developer_private_api_unittest.cc |
index 8e172c31eea8a665cdfa266b844a21ea8a670ce5..508c7db0c2583325f80475923f7bc6f55bb1992e 100644 |
--- a/chrome/browser/extensions/api/developer_private/developer_private_api_unittest.cc |
+++ b/chrome/browser/extensions/api/developer_private/developer_private_api_unittest.cc |
@@ -106,7 +106,7 @@ class DeveloperPrivateApiUnitTest : public ExtensionServiceTestBase { |
std::unique_ptr<TestBrowserWindow> browser_window_; |
std::unique_ptr<Browser> browser_; |
- ScopedVector<TestExtensionDir> test_extension_dirs_; |
+ std::vector<std::unique_ptr<TestExtensionDir>> test_extension_dirs_; |
DISALLOW_COPY_AND_ASSIGN(DeveloperPrivateApiUnitTest); |
}; |
@@ -128,8 +128,8 @@ const Extension* DeveloperPrivateApiUnitTest::LoadUnpackedExtension() { |
" \"permissions\": [\"*://*/*\"]" |
"}"; |
- test_extension_dirs_.push_back(new TestExtensionDir); |
- TestExtensionDir* dir = test_extension_dirs_.back(); |
+ test_extension_dirs_.push_back(base::MakeUnique<TestExtensionDir>()); |
+ TestExtensionDir* dir = test_extension_dirs_.back().get(); |
dir->WriteManifest(kManifest); |
// TODO(devlin): We should extract out methods to load an unpacked extension |